Weather

Rainy

June to November - wet and humid

Summer

March to May - hot and dry

Winter

December to February - cool and dry

Local Transportation:

Once you arrive in Pogonsili, getting around the area is relatively easy. Tricycles, a common mode of transportation in the Philippines, are readily available and can take you to various attractions within the town. You can also rent a motorbike or bicycle to explore the surroundings at your own pace.
